Thad joined the Colorado technology community in 1999 as a Senior Software Developer at Denver-based digital product development firm Spire Digital (then known as SpireMedia) where he developed Web applications including eCommerce, search engine, and content management platforms for Spire’s first generation of clients. As CTO at Spire, Batt led cross-functional teams of developers, UX/UI, and project managers innovating at the forefront of Web 2.0 through custom digital product development for mobile, social media, and web where he got his first look at blockchain-based technology by accident. While building out a DevOps practice in 2014 he discovered a compromised customer application server – it had been cryptojacked and was being used for mining Bitcoin. After patching the attack vector and reverse engineering the malware, he became interested in the underlying technology. In 2017 he started Blockchain Industries Llc as a blockchain operations (blockops) consultancy helping software developers automate the process of running and configuring nodes for bitcoin- and ethereum-like blockchains. He joined the Colorado Governor’s Office of Information Technology in April 2019 as the State’s first Blockchain and DLT Solution Architect tasked with research and development of the State’s blockchain-related use cases, infrastructure design, applications integrations, and reference architectures.
